Локальный артефакт jfrog не разрешает некоторые зависимости - PullRequest
0 голосов
/ 05 мая 2020

в нашем локальном артефакте jfrog есть странная проблема только с некоторыми зависимостями. Например, у нас есть проблемы с артефактом jSerialComm версии 2.6.x. Версия 2.5.3 была загружена и кэширована, и она работает нормально, но когда я пробую версию 2.6.1 или любую другую версию 2.6, она просто не может ее найти. Maven говорит:

Не удалось найти артефакт com.fazecast: jSerialComm: jar: 2.6.1 в центре

Я подозревал, что это может быть проблема с именем (заглавными буквами), поэтому я развернул его напрямую и изменил все заглавные буквы на маленькие и что-то добавили к имени и тут все заработало. Если бы я сохранил ту же группу и имя артефакта, это не сработало бы.

Тогда, например, apache cxf plugin. Новые версии просто не загружаются, только те, которые уже есть.

Я использую пользователя с правами администратора, а для администратора написано, что он может делать что угодно ... Что мне делать, чтобы это работало? Вам нужна другая информация, чтобы помочь мне? Спасибо!

1 Ответ

0 голосов
/ 06 мая 2020

После некоторого дополнительного исследования я обнаружил, что mvnrepository.com был добавлен правильно. Эти артефакты начали работать, как только я заменил значение URL с:

mvnrepository.com

на

https://repo1.maven.org/maven2/

Надеюсь, это кому-то поможет.

...